Default A few problems

I have a few buddies of mine playing eq with me, and they are having a lot of problems. I will try to get the specs of there comp but I know this much.

First problem is that this person is getting a no 3d devices found error whenever they try to play the game and lauch from eqemu. I have looked at a bunch of forums posts and done searches. What I found out is that in there device manager there display driver had a yellow exclamation point. I looked up the properties and it has a Error Code 39 (broken or damaged driver). I have tried to update the driver and it says that it has the most current driver. Could you please help me with this problem.

Windows 7 64 bit. 2GB RAM, Direct x 11,


The second problem is the other person has EQ up and running they can play the game and join the server, but sometimes when they go to the second server list there are no servers. The other problem they are having is that sometimes when they zone the game freezes they waited 15 minutes on a black screen. Now there roommate using the same internet has had none of these problems at all, they can play the game just fine with no problems.

Windows 7 64 bit 8GB RAM, Direct x 11
